No third party accelerators are supported by A/UX (which means nothing as
far as whether or not they'll run it). According to folks on CompuServe,
however, the Dove upgrade definitely won't run A/UX.

If you have the new Apple ROMs, A/UX will work with the Dove 030.
I believe that you get the new ROMs as part of the Apple floppy
upgrade.

This is not conjecture.  They are running A/UX at Dove with this
configuration.
